新聞中心
我們需要?jiǎng)?chuàng)建一個(gè)Angular組件,并在其中使用ngFor指令動(dòng)態(tài)生成表格,以下是一個(gè)簡單的示例:

為新化等地區(qū)用戶提供了全套網(wǎng)頁設(shè)計(jì)制作服務(wù),及新化網(wǎng)站建設(shè)行業(yè)解決方案。主營業(yè)務(wù)為成都做網(wǎng)站、成都網(wǎng)站設(shè)計(jì)、新化網(wǎng)站設(shè)計(jì),以傳統(tǒng)方式定制建設(shè)網(wǎng)站,并提供域名空間備案等一條龍服務(wù),秉承以專業(yè)、用心的態(tài)度為用戶提供真誠的服務(wù)。我們深信只要達(dá)到每一位用戶的要求,就會得到認(rèn)可,從而選擇與我們長期合作。這樣,我們也可以走得更遠(yuǎn)!
1、創(chuàng)建一個(gè)名為app.component.html的文件,內(nèi)容如下:
動(dòng)態(tài)生成的表格
標(biāo)題1 標(biāo)題2 標(biāo)題3 {{ item.title1 }} {{ item.title2 }} {{ item.title3 }}
2、在app.component.ts文件中,添加以下代碼:
import { Component } from '@angular/core';
@Component({
selector: 'approot',
templateUrl: './app.component.html',
styleUrls: ['./app.component.css']
})
export class AppComponent {
title = '動(dòng)態(tài)表格示例';
items = [
{ title1: '數(shù)據(jù)1', title2: '數(shù)據(jù)2', title3: '數(shù)據(jù)3' },
{ title1: '數(shù)據(jù)4', title2: '數(shù)據(jù)5', title3: '數(shù)據(jù)6' },
{ title1: '數(shù)據(jù)7', title2: '數(shù)據(jù)8', title3: '數(shù)據(jù)9' }
];
}
接下來,我們將創(chuàng)建一個(gè)相關(guān)問題與解答的欄目,在app.component.html文件中,添加以下代碼:
相關(guān)問題與解答
問題1:如何使用ngFor指令動(dòng)態(tài)生成表格?
答:在Angular組件中,可以使用
*ngFor指令和數(shù)組來動(dòng)態(tài)生成表格,在上面的示例中,我們創(chuàng)建了一個(gè)名為items的數(shù)組,并使用*ngFor指令遍歷該數(shù)組以生成表格的每一行。問題2:如何為表格添加樣式?
答:可以在組件的CSS文件中為表格添加樣式,在上面的示例中,我們在
app.component.css文件中添加了以下代碼:table { width: 100%; bordercollapse: collapse; } th, td { border: 1px solid black; padding: 8px; textalign: left; } th { backgroundcolor: #f2f2f2; }
現(xiàn)在,當(dāng)運(yùn)行應(yīng)用程序時(shí),將顯示一個(gè)動(dòng)態(tài)生成的表格和一個(gè)相關(guān)問題與解答的欄目。
標(biāo)題名稱:HTML使用ngFor動(dòng)態(tài)生成Angular表格
路徑分享:http://www.dlmjj.cn/article/cdjddpo.html


咨詢
建站咨詢
